Nothing is more important than investing in Norwalk’s infrastructure. That means investing in maintenance, too. Things like bridge repairs, road improvements, and addressing flood-prone areas are not the glamorous issues that you hear people talking about.

No one likes to pay higher taxes and fees. As a council member, I have always tried to make sure that taxpayers’ money is spent wisely along with making sure that there’s accountability for all our government expenditures. As a Council member, we don’t get a say in how our educational tax dollars are spent, but I feel it is important that educational dollars be delivered to the classroom, NOT to the boardroom.
